a) The experiment is a binomial experiment because of the following reasons
(i) Binomial experiment has a fixed number of trials, from the statement the experiment has a fixed number of trial, the trial is to check whether the overall state of moral value in the United State is poor or not and a fixed sample of 25 is being considered
(ii) In a binomial experiment, each trial is independent of one another
(iii) In a binomial experiment, there are only two possible outcomes, which are success or failure, yes or no, good or bad etc. from the statement the outcomes are poor or rich
(iv) The probability of each outcome remain constant throughout the experiment , from the experiment above, the probability of "poor" is 0.45 which is denoted p and that of "rich is 0.55 , which is denoted with q
(b) Using the binomial distribution formula: N = 25 , p = 0.45 , q = 0.55 P(X=r)=n∁r p^r q^(n-r)
P(X=15)=25∁15 〖(0.45)〗^15 〖(0.55)〗^10
P(X=15)=3268760×0.0000062833×0.00253295162
P(X=15)=0.052
